. The show went down in Montreal, home to Arcade Fire, at the halftime of an annual charity basketball game called POP Vs. Jock that the Butler brothers organized. As if forming the supergroup that indie dreams are made of wasn't enough, the crew also treated the benefit's audience to a basketball game where they, along with NBA players, faced off against college basketball players. Their team, Team Pop, took home the win at 101-92. In their performance, Pop All Star Band covered Phil Collins' "In the Air Tonight" and The White Stripes' "Seven Nation Army," with help from Arcade Fire's R�gine Chassagne and other AF members.
